We have a Litter due 1/22/08.

This is a second breeding for our dog "Kigers Stonehouse Express"

We have bred her to a nice Trial dog owned by Lee Herskowitz, "Semper Duece Cooper***". Cooper is all age qualified with an amatuer win.
He has a ton of go! You can get more information on Cooper at Lee's website "Semper Retrievers" Lee has been in the "golden" Business for many years.

You can view both dogs pedgrees at K9data.com for free. Just type or paste their names in.

As mentioned this is a second breeding for our dog Shawno". The sire of her first litter was Coopers sire, Kai. (See Lees website). Though none of the pups have been trialed or tested, several have been hunted and done very well. I was fortunate enough to train with 4 of the pups. I have a pretty good background in retrievers and was really pleased with the pups. To the point that we are keeping one with the hope of getting back in the trial/test game.

Shawno has been a very good hunting companion. I havent trialed or tested her but she has all the right stuff! She can run multiple marks and has run blinds to over 200 yards. (Good blinds!) She is at home chukar hunting as she is in a duck or goose blind. (Shes a great chukar dog).

Shawnos hips were OFA good at 6 years of age. She has CERF. I have not done her elbows but shes 7 1/2 and hunted chukars 4 days in a row last december with no ill effects. Im pretty sure theres nothing wrong with the elbows

Females from the last litter run about 55 -60 pounds at a year and half, Males about 60 tp 65.

Mom runs about 65 pounds when in good shape. Cooper I think is 65 lbs.
